I have no problem with it. Dell GX620 with a 2007WFP ( running at 1680x1050 wide screen
with no panning ).
xorg-x11-server-Xorg-1.1.1-5.fc6
xorg-x11-drv-i810-1.6.0-11.20060713modeset.fc6
Couple of things from my config, you need the correct settings for modline and Display.
Mine are :
DisplaySize 434 272
ModeLine "1680x1050" 146.2 1680 1784 1960 2240 1050 1053 1059 1089 -hsync
+vsync
